CVE-2026-0407: Authentication bypass in NETGEAR WiFi Range Extenders via network adjacent attacks
An insufficient authentication vulnerability in NETGEAR WiFi range extenders allows a network adjacent attacker with WiFi authentication or a physical Ethernet port connection to bypass the authentication process and access the admin panel.

What is the severity of CVE-2026-0407?
CVE-2026-0407 is classified as a high severity vulnerability due to its potential to allow unauthorized access.
How do I fix CVE-2026-0407?
To fix CVE-2026-0407, update your NETGEAR WiFi range extender to the latest firmware version as provided by NETGEAR.
Who is affected by CVE-2026-0407?
CVE-2026-0407 affects users of specific NETGEAR WiFi range extenders who have not applied the latest security updates.
What type of attack is associated with CVE-2026-0407?
CVE-2026-0407 allows for network adjacent attacks which can bypass the authentication mechanisms of the devices.
What are the risks of CVE-2026-0407?
The risks of CVE-2026-0407 include unauthorized access to the network, potentially leading to data breaches and network exploitation.
